After gastric resection surgery, which of the following signs and symptoms would alert the nurse to the development of a leaking anastomosis
A. Pain, fever, and abdominal rigidity.
B. Diarrhea with fat in the stool.
C. Palpitations, pallor, and diaphoresis after eating.
D. Feelings of fullness and nausea after eatin
答案
参考答案:A
解析:Pain, fever, and abdominal rigidity are signs and symptoms of inflammation or peritonitis caused by the leaking anastomosis.
